I think expecting a great race surface is a reach. Lets face it, Eldora sits dark most of the summer and its a guessing game every time they race. Lets keep it real. Poeple comment on how Port Royal or Knoxvile is always in great shape on race day. Its no mystery to a thinking person. Those tracks are raced on weekly and the track prep and owners have a constant and reliable grip on the race surface. And every week learn about how to make it better. When a track sits dark most of the year, be reasonable, How do you expect them to really know what that race surface is going to do? Eldora is too big to guess on a good race surface. If Eldora was 1/3 mile or 3/8 I think it would be much easier and more forgiving if you dont have a clue what the track is going to do.
